Q: Is 440,234,140 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 440,234,140 is not a prime number.

Why is 440,234,140 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 440234140 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 20 37 74 148 185 370 740 594,911 1,189,822 2,379,644 2,974,555 5,949,110 11,898,220 22,011,707 44,023,414 88,046,828 110,058,535 220,117,070 and 440,234,140, with no remainder.

Since 440,234,140 cannot be divided by just 1 and 440,234,140, it is not a prime number.
